Application Administrator (Job Number:403904)
Description:
SAIC currently has an opening for an Application Administrator to support a Department of State (DoS) Bureau of Information Resource Management (IRM) program. This program provides transparent, interconnected systems and security supporting the DoS in successfully carrying out its U.S. foreign policy mission. IRM provides enterprise architecture design, engineering, operations and maintenance support services for desktops, servers, networks, firewalls, and enterprise applications across the Department. Program is named "Vanguard 2.2.1" and is an IT consolidation consisting of the Department's servers, mainframes, network devices, network perimeter, anti-virus engineering, public key infrastructure (PKI)/biometrics/encryption, monitoring tools, telephony, mobile computing platform, virtual environment, and enclave design/security engineering.
JOB DESCRIPTION
This position is within the Vanguard 2.2.1 program’s Enterprise Security Office (ESO), supporting assessment and authorization (A&A) of the DoS unclassified network, classified network, and external network connections. The applicationautomates major activities within the A&A lifecycle process as well as the production of security package artifacts. This position will require significant interaction with the DoS and contractor staff and with the DoS Information Assurance (IA) office. The work location is in the Washington, D.C. Metropolitan area.
Responsibilities include:
- Application configuration and administration in support of A&A process in the the DoS environment.
- Maintain, manage, and upgrade the application and underlying host platform components in both test and operational environments. Host platform components include web servers, a relational database such as Microsoft SQL Server or Oracle (including clustering), and Microsoft Windows Server operating system.
- Develop user training materials, including quick reference guides as well as application maintenance references and SOPs.
- Develop and maintain system security documentation.
- Establish, maintain and operate a contingency response and disaster recovery capability.
- Provide help-desk support to application users.
- Collaborate with system owners, IA system owner support, and IA security control assessors to adapt the solution to meet IA mission objectives.
- Implement procedures to support recurring and ad hoc reporting requirements.
- Support and interact with customers, at the highest levels, as required.
